Output 86634e8a77d4f05617b83a4ed39b91e28f7201473dfff9b916c4133eeef98528:0

value
545843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aff66a9c874c7f0c002a4f69658275e0d154adde OP_EQUAL
address
3HjRNRrEX9FXNH1CgUB8o8Cz2pMGzwaw5D
transaction
86634e8a77d4f05617b83a4ed39b91e28f7201473dfff9b916c4133eeef98528